What is a Built-In Oven?
A built-in oven, as the name recommends, is integrated into the kitchen area cabinets rather than being a freestanding device. This design allows it to mix seamlessly with the total style of the kitchen area, creating a structured look. Built-in ovens are available in different styles and configurations, including single ovens, double ovens, wall ovens, and microwave-convection oven mixes.
Advantages of Built-In Ovens
Space-Saving Design: Built-in ovens are perfect for smaller sized cooking areas where counter space is at a premium. By incorporating the oven into the kitchen cabinetry, property owners can maximize their kitchen area's design without sacrificing vital home appliances.
Customization: Available in different sizes, colors, and surfaces, built-in ovens can be customized to match the cooking area design and individual preferences. From smooth stainless-steel to classic black or white, the choices are virtually endless.
Improved Cooking Performance: Many built-in ovens come geared up with advanced technology, consisting of convection heating, self-cleaning features, and clever connectivity. This means better heat distribution, much faster cooking times, and the convenience of keeping track of cooking development from your smartphone.
Ergonomic Placement: Unlike traditional ovens, which typically require flexing down to gain access to, built-in ovens can be set at a comfortable height for the user. This ergonomic positioning lowers pressure on the back and makes it easier to handle dishes out of the oven.

Maintenance and Care
While built-in ovens included various advantages, they do require regular upkeep to ensure durability and efficiency. Here are a couple of pointers for keeping your home appliance in top shape:
Routine Cleaning: Keep the interior clean by regularly cleaning it down and using the self-cleaning function if offered. Prevent utilizing abrasive cleaners that might scratch the surface area.

Examine Seals and Gaskets: Inspect the door seals and gaskets regularly to ensure there are no leaks. A tight seal improves energy efficiency and cooking efficiency.
Professional Servicing: Schedule routine maintenance with a certified professional to capture any potential issues early and keep your oven running efficiently.
